Real-Time Environment Interactions
The integration of artificial intelligence within the metaverse is expected to revolutionize real-time interactions between users and their environments. With advancements in AI virtual reality, immersive experiences will become increasingly dynamic and responsive, providing a more engaging user experience. One of the key attributes of these immersive environments will be their ability to adapt in real-time based on users’ actions, creating a fluid digital ecosystem that mirrors the unpredictability of the physical world.
One significant aspect of this evolving interaction is the development of AI-driven non-player characters (NPCs). Unlike traditional NPCs, which usually follow predefined scripts and behaviors, AI avatars are set to facilitate more lifelike interactions with users. These avatars will adapt their responses based on user input and environmental cues. As AI algorithms become more sophisticated, NPCs will be capable of recognizing emotions, understanding context, and engaging in meaningful conversations, thus enhancing user experience within gaming and social platforms in the metaverse.
Examples of technologies poised to enable these transformations include advanced machine learning algorithms that can process vast amounts of data to predict user behavior and preferences. Moreover, computer vision technologies will allow avatars and environments to interpret visual cues from user interactions, further enhancing the interactivity of the digital ecosystem. These technologies not only augment user experience but also open up possibilities for personalized gaming experiences and social interactions.

Challenges and Ethical Considerations
The integration of AI technologies within the metaverse presents a variety of challenges and ethical considerations that merit careful examination. As we approach 2025, the prevalence of AI in virtual environments, particularly in the context of AI avatars and AI immersive experiences, raises significant concerns regarding data privacy. Users engaging in AI virtual reality experiences often share vast amounts of personal data, which can be susceptible to misuse. Ensuring the confidentiality of this data is essential, as breaches could result in severe ramifications for user trust and safety.
Additionally, the transparency of AI decision-making processes becomes increasingly pertinent. In environments where AI avatars interact with users, it is crucial that these systems operate in a manner that is understandable and accountable. Users must be aware of how their data influences AI behavior, as well as how decisions are made within these virtual worlds. Without proper transparency, there is potential for AI systems to make biased decisions or behave unpredictably, which could undermine the foundational purpose of creating immersive and engaging experiences.
Moreover, the potential for misuse of AI technologies poses an ethical conundrum. The same features that enhance our interactions in the metaverse could also be exploited for malicious purposes, such as creating fake identities or manipulating user behaviors.
